    Oct 14, 2007, 12:28 PM
    Hi there,

    What I had to do was go into my network settings and

    Select 'Use the following IP Address:

    IP Address 192.168.0.2
    Subnet Mask 255.255.255.0 (or if not, just let it be default)
    Default Gateway 192.168.0.1

    You can then ping 192.168.0.1 and you should be able to go in IE using that address and get into your router.

    Remember to change it back to auto IP when finished.
